summaryrefslogtreecommitdiff
tag namebtree-key-enhancements_2022-10-14 (6966a0d9c81dbd361c4d099585514c53b9f6ee09)
tag date2022-10-14 14:18:21 -0700
tagged byDarrick J. Wong <djwong@kernel.org>
tagged objectcommit fb3002944d...
xfs: enhance btree key checking
This series addresses some deficiencies in btree key comparisons that I noticed while testing online scrub. The first fixes a bug in the rmap key comparison that prevents the rmap scrubber from detecting rmap records for file space allocations with mismatched attr/bmbt flags. The second patch fixes the scrub btree block checker to ensure that the keys in the parent block accurately represent the block. Signed-off-by: Darrick J. Wong <djwong@kernel.org> -----BEGIN PGP SIGNATURE----- iQIzBAABCgAdFiEEUzaAxoMeQq6m2jMV+H93GTRKtOsFAmNJ0h0ACgkQ+H93GTRK tOsYFg//QGcpKTbC1jWchufbb/JCvmn+bAvASemZU/6rb0ODJEOCSjloi0x1jKVr 8te5OsEAGcI44QDRCzXkEvysoHnY8j99yqtsE/jkGupiKfZWbFVaVrq6ABBLaVtK b38QIwX2moP45N/FBdFuByD1eBrxTcWnpcLpa0wBTlZDDc1feNEUZNF5qOrmCGtu rBJnzVVKngMOB2R2PLh7PM7z+hRzA+DWpiRJV0ZPktcNEnedMq+0ffl5mpBhQ+vk Tby0qRm0bBTCPD7Q5Ss2CwIQQeKbfng5fvQZBufSn0Dawfgy1McfJa0xQEBd1kZ4 Bj/L7jGSp4T9hpUdLRFGpXACqp/Oa0o/nAIqFqY9YCoIre9DZkt3LagkK3VVAzWL Xazvm73yA9YQVkV8k1RdMprCLpODgQXJC2eoSawljbveXxDkGZymxLyG0yrPY0Tn 1jYm0MFuPgRwarSId15OziJT4Mma9nshGPmysmDlP88K8QDBfVPgO7Z6OSpsHo2E sldoY2zcXkPT5rILjVjRZdhJFxhXBDlthTrgRgzyCJzLiWtawrZLYipVigw7iI2W gg9dx1+1M9al4iF6PnnaIQyWwosmtHbamkMyu9VSDF70ejdHtlTwe9tgXr8W3h5H owety8vgz+MnC+ynlsJt0KobpKFDJI0Yt3D40vmsqX1q45jhFQA= =O+Wy -----END PGP SIGNATURE-----